 Parental go away in Canada

The Canadian authorities mandates each depart and a advantages thing, the latter of which is administered by provincial employment coverage plans. Underneath the phrases of the federal go away software, parents can take advantage of widespread or prolonged advantages. The only you select can determine the wide variety of weeks you're eligible to get hold of blessings and what kind of you acquire.6

These blessings are designed for those who are faraway from paintings due to the fact they're pregnant or have lately given delivery or folks who are far from paintings to care for a new child or newly adopted baby.6 Employers are required to accept personnel who take benefit of federal parental leave blessings returned into their jobs (or the equivalent) at the quit of the mandated go away on the equal charge of pay with the same employment benefits.
Maternity benefits

Maternity blessings are to be had to the person that is away from paintings due to the fact they may be pregnant or have recently given start. A person who is receiving maternity blessings will also be entitled to parental advantages.

In case you're eligible for maternity benefits you could receive benefits same to 55% of your average weekly insurable salary, up to a maximum of $595 per week. This gain is paid for 15 weeks.6
Parental blessings

Parental blessings can be paid to the parents of a new child or newly adopted toddler. That includes moms who're taking maternity blessings. You could pick out between trendy parental blessings or prolonged parental advantages.6

Parental benefits may be shared between mother and father. If you plan to proportion them, you both have to pick standard or prolonged advantages. Right here's how the 2 options compare.
So, as an example, a new mother should take the entire 15 weeks of maternity blessings she's allowed. She could also take a further 35 weeks of trendy parental blessings. If she have been to select prolonged parental advantages as an alternative, she'd be capable of take 61 weeks similarly to her 15 weeks of maternity blessings. Altogether, she'd qualify for seventy six weeks of go away.
 Maternity and Parental leave inside the united states

In the usa, the picture for families-to-be could be very one-of-a-kind. The federal circle of relatives and clinical depart Act (FMLA) signed into regulation in 1993 requires employers to provide as much as 12 weeks of unpaid leave for several medical conditions, in addition to the start of a baby.2

To be eligible for unpaid maternity or parental go away, you should:

    Have worked for his or her agency for at least 365 days
    Have labored at least 1,250 hours during the last 365 days
    paintings at a vicinity where the corporation employs 50 or extra personnel within seventy five miles2

If the parent has pre-delivery complications, she may be able to take a part of the depart underneath the medical issue. Before the regulation was enacted, the U.S. Had no legal guidelines requiring that employers provide any go away. There are still gaping holes within the FMLA, but.

For example, the act exempts small employers defined as those having fewer than 50 employees from having to offer unpaid go away. Even though it is really worth noting that some states, such as California and New Jersey, encompass pregnancy blessings as part of the kingdom's disability coverage plan, which offers at least a partial offset of lost profits.

California, for instance, offers up to 4 weeks of paid go away for everyday pregnancies and up to eight weeks for moms who go through a cesarean segment.7 even though it truly is useful, it still falls a ways quick of the advantages afforded to Canadian dad and mom.
